Types of Basin Mixers: A Comprehensive Overview

When selecting basin mixers, understanding the types available can greatly impact your decision. There are several key categories, including single-lever mixers, dual-lever mixers, and mixer taps. Each has unique features tailored to different needs and aesthetics.

Single-lever mixers offer convenience with a simple control mechanism for both temperature and flow. They are often minimalistic and suit modern designs well. However, some users may find them less precise in temperature control.

Dual-lever mixers, on the other hand, provide more control over water temperature and flow. They feature separate controls for hot and cold water. This design appeals to those who prioritize accuracy but may not be as user-friendly for quick adjustments.

Mixer taps are another option and can vary widely in style. They tend to be traditional and may require more maintenance due to their complexity.

While these types offer various advantages, they also come with potential drawbacks. For example, single-lever mixers may be less ideal for households with young children, where precise temperature control is crucial. Limited space in small bathrooms can hinder the use of dual-lever mixers perfectly. Assess your needs carefully before making a choice.

Ultimately, finding the right basin mixer involves understanding these types and how they fit your lifestyle and home design.

Installation and Maintenance Tips for Basin Mixers

When choosing basin mixers, installation and maintenance are vital. Proper installation ensures functionality and longevity. Start by checking the water supply lines. They must align with the mixer’s inlet. It’s essential to use proper tools and techniques to prevent leaks. According to a 2021 report by the Bathroom Manufacturers Association, improper installation can lead to a 30% increase in water wastage.

Regular maintenance is equally important. Clean the aerator frequently to prevent mineral buildup. A simple vinegar solution can work wonders. The National Association of Home Builders recommends checking for leaks monthly, as early detection can save homeowners up to $1,000 annually.

Be mindful of the materials used. Brass mixers are more durable than plastic counterparts. However, they may need more frequent cleaning. Remember, small neglects can lead to bigger issues. A thoughtful approach to installation and care can provide a hassle-free experience.
